Super Pokémon Rumble is set to arrive in Europe early this December. This is the first Pokémon title to be released exclusively for the 3DS.

In a refreshing change of direction from the well known Pokémon series loved by one and all (where players start out as a trainer and strive to become the Pokémon League Champion), Super Pokémon Rumble delves into the world of controlling Toy Pokémon against waves of other Toy Pokémon, in a real time battling system.

“Toy Pokémon?” I hear you ask? Using a “Wonder Key” pours life into the toys as though they were living and breathing companions. Just like the other versions of Pokémon, you can battle hard and collect them all!

As you advance through each stage in Super Pokémon Rumble, your Toy Pokémon can face dozens of other Toy Pokémon at once, creating fast and furious real-time battles. You can quickly and easily switch between the various Toy Pokémon you collect throughout the game to help win each battle. Get ready to also face off against giant Boss Pokémon, whose massive size and strength offer special challenges. Certain defeated Toy Pokémon can be befriended and added to your team, and you can also collect special Toy Pokémon, each with their own unique traits. There are more than 600 Toy Pokémon in all to collect, including those from the recently released Pokémon Black Version and Pokémon White Version games.

Super Pokémon Rumble offers two ways for you to wirelessly connect with your friends. Using a local wireless connection, you can enjoy a cooperative play mode that allows you and your friend to battle through levels together and more easily befriend defeated Toy Pokémon after battles. Using the Nintendo 3DS StreetPass™ feature, you can increase the chances of befriending Mythical and Legendary Pokémon, challenge the Toy Pokémon of players you pass in your daily travels and view other players’ Mii™ characters in the game.

Super Pokémon Rumble will be available on the 2nd of December for 3DS.
